asked 03/14/21What is the terminal speed?
A rain drop of mass 0.034 gram with a radius of 0.2 cm attains a terminal speed when the drag force is equal to its weight (W=mg). Give air density 1.21 kg/m^3, effective surface area of the drop can be treated as
A= π*r^2. Drag coefficient C=1.
Calculate the terminal speed.
